Job Description
General Purpose of Job:
Under the direction of the Gift Shop Supervisor, the Gift Shop Coordinator oversees the daily operations of the UM Health-Sparrow Gift Shop, ensuring exceptional customer service, efficient inventory management, and effective volunteer coordination.
Essential Duties
This job description is intended to cover the minimum essential duties assigned on a regular basis. Associates may be asked to perform additional duties as assigned by their leader. Leadership has the right to alter or modify the duties of the position.
Inventory Management
- Manage inventory levels to ensure accurate financial reporting and minimize shrinkage.
- Receive, unpack, and process merchandise deliveries, accurately entering new inventory into the Counterpoint retail management system.
- Perform the data entry and receiving functions required to bring new inventory into Counterpoint, including creating and matching purchase orders, entering item and vendor details, verifying quantities and pricing against packing slips and invoices, and researching and resolving any receiving discrepancies.
- Ensure all merchandise is properly tagged, displayed, and secured.
- Maintain a clean and organized backstock area.
- Develop and maintain the volunteer schedule, ensuring adequate floor coverage.
- Provide orientation, training, and ongoing coaching to gift shop volunteers.
- Communicate regularly with volunteers regarding sales, markdowns, policies, and procedures.
- Foster a positive and supportive volunteer environment.
- Provide exceptional customer service, including greeting customers, offering product recommendations, and resolving inquiries and disputes.
- Process sales transactions, balance registers, and prepare deposits.
- Maintain a clean and organized store environment.
- Enforce the dress code to maintain a professional appearance that reflects the UM Health-Sparrow brand.
- Ensure compliance with all hospital and gift shop policies and procedures.
- Create and display signage to promote sales and communicate important information, adhering to UM Health-Sparrow brand guidelines.
- Assist with daily register closeout and balancing.
- Provide backup coverage for the gift shop as needed.
- Serve as the primary point of contact for IT related to the Counterpoint POS system and other retail technology.
